Mold Detection in Broward County, FL
Mold detection services involve thorough assessments to identify the presence of mold growth within a property. These services typically include visual inspections and the use of specialized equipment to locate hidden mold behind walls, under flooring, or within HVAC systems. Homeowners often request mold detection when experiencing unexplained musty odors, visible mold patches, or health concerns that may be linked to mold exposure. Projects can range from routine inspections following water damage to comprehensive evaluations in cases of ongoing moisture issues or suspected hidden contamination.

Common Mold Detection Jobs
Mold Inspection - identifies hidden mold growth in residential and commercial properties.
Moisture Assessment - detects sources of excess moisture that promote mold development.
Air Quality Testing - measures airborne mold spores to assess indoor air safety.
Surface Sampling - collects samples from walls, ceilings, and other surfaces for mold presence.
Post-Remediation Testing - verifies mold removal effectiveness after cleanup efforts.
Comprehensive Mold Evaluation - provides a detailed report on mold risks and recommended actions.
Mold Detection Questions
What is mold detection? Mold detection involves identifying the presence of mold in indoor environments, often through visual inspection and specialized testing methods.
When should homeowners consider mold detection? Mold detection is recommended if there are signs of water damage, persistent odors, or visible mold growth in the property.
What areas are typically tested during mold detection? Common areas include bathrooms, kitchens, basements, attics, and any spaces with moisture issues or past water exposure.
How does mold detection benefit property owners? It helps identify hidden mold issues early, supporting effective remediation and maintaining indoor air quality.
